Here in the Philippines, we see different types of houses, the nipa huts, wooden houses and concrete houses. In the early days, nipa huts were the houses of Filipinos, but time came when houses built were wooden and concrete houses with gabled and ridge roofings. I prefer a concrete house because it's more durable and could withstand strong winds although sometimes it's hot inside. I would love to live in a nipa hut or a wooden house because it would be very relaxing to stay in those types of houses. What type of house is your house and what would you prefer to have?
